Before booting from this image, you should verify its integrity using the command line. Oracle provides official checksums for all Solaris releases. 1. Generate the Checksum

Oracle Solaris 11.3 is a legacy release (October 2015), and official downloads are primarily managed through My Oracle Support (MOS) Oracle Software Delivery Cloud sol-11_3-text-sparc.iso Target Architecture : SPARC (64-bit) Verification Method : SHA-256 (preferred) or MD5 checksums.
